Window Shopping

My finger trembled, pressed SELECT. Your catalogue entry left me unable to resist.


Hidden motors whirred. The shutter opened. You couldn’t see me but you knew; your posture told me. They always knew. You sat with catlike defiance with a glimmer in your eyes I ached to snuff out.


But I’d never own you. Not me, who'd sat in a capsule like yours. An actual Person would master you. My Owner, busy, left me to browse and dream. An impossible, rebellious dream.


I turned away.


The restlessness remained. Was I once like you? Did my eyes glimmer?
 

I can't remember.
